XAMPP против базовой Windows - PullRequest
       18

XAMPP против базовой Windows

0 голосов
/ 04 февраля 2009

Я устанавливаю приложение с открытым исходным кодом, Laconica, для микроблогов. Есть инструкции по его установке с использованием XAMPP. Теперь я предпочитаю делать прямую установку Windows. При этом у меня возникли некоторые проблемы, связанные с отсутствующими переменными, неправильными определениями переменных БД и т. Д. Теперь мой коллега хочет попробовать использовать XAMPP. Но мой вопрос: почему XAMPP разрешит мои проблемы? Как может инструмент, который помогает настроить, исправить эти неотъемлемые переменные и проблемы с БД? Я что-то пропустил? Мне кажется, что XAMPP настраивает приложение для работы в конкретной среде, тогда как проблемы, которые я решаю, связаны с написанным реальным PHP-кодом.

Ответы [ 2 ]

2 голосов
/ 04 февраля 2009

XAMPP поставляется со всеми зависимостями, необходимыми для запуска Laconica в одном пакете. Возможно, у вас сейчас другая версия PHP или база данных, которую ищет Laconica.

XAMPP не устанавливает apache, PHP и т. Д. Он равен apache, PHP и т. Д.

Не зная, в чем заключаются ваши ошибки, трудно сказать, какие проблемы может решить XAMPP, поскольку мы не знаем, какие у вас проблемы сейчас.

1 голос
/ 28 апреля 2009

Для более ранних версий Laconica мы не установили E_NOTICE для наших сред разработки - по умолчанию отключено E_NOTICE для систем Ubuntu. Таким образом, люди, использующие другие среды, могут видеть «ошибки», которых мы не видели.

Это было исправлено в более поздних версиях; Я думаю, что сейчас у нас все хорошо с ошибками уведомления.

Вы также можете поместить эту строку в ваш config.php, чтобы отключить уведомления об уведомлении:

 error_reporting(E_ALL ^ E_NOTICE);

Вы почти наверняка должны отключить уведомления об ошибках в браузере, например:

 ini_set('display_errors', false);
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...